Kainchi Dham, nestled in the Kumaon hills of Uttarakhand, is a serene spiritual destination that draws devotees, yogis, and curious travelers from across the world. The temple and ashram, founded by the revered saint Neem Karoli Baba (Maharaj-ji) in 1962, are known for their peaceful aura, beautiful setting beside a clear river, and the powerful sense of devotion felt by every visitor.

Overview of Kainchi Dham
- Location: Kainchi Village, near Bhowali, District Nainital, Uttarakhand
- Altitude: Approximately 1,400 meters above sea level
- Nearest City: Nainital (17 km away)
- Distance from Delhi: Around 340 km (depending on route)
- Darshan Timings: 5 AM – 4 PM (may vary during special events)
- Famous For: Neem Karoli Baba Ashram, Hanuman Temple, and Kainchi Dham Mela (celebrated every June 15)

Route Summary: Delhi → Kainchi Dham
- Total Distance: ~340 km
- Average Travel Time: 8–10 hours by road
- Major Route: Delhi → Hapur → Moradabad → Rampur → Rudrapur → Haldwani → Bhimtal → Bhowali → Kainchi Dham
Delhi to Kainchi Dham by Taxi (Cab)
Overview
Traveling by taxi is the most convenient and comfortable way to reach Kainchi Dham directly from Delhi. It allows you to travel at your own pace, stop for meals, and enjoy scenic views along the route.
Distance and Time
- Distance: Approximately 340 km
- Duration: 8–9 hours (depending on traffic and weather)
Taxi Route Map
Delhi → Ghaziabad → Hapur → Moradabad → Rampur → Rudrapur → Haldwani → Bhimtal → Bhowali → Kainchi Dham
Taxi Fare (2025 Estimate)
Vehicle Type| One-Way Fare (₹)| Round Trip (₹)| Notes
Hatchback (Wagon R, Swift)| 5,500 – 6,000| 9,000 – 10,000| Budget friendly
Sedan (Dzire, Etios)| 6,000 – 7,500| 10,000 – 12,000| Comfortable for 4 people
SUV (Ertiga, Innova)| 8,000 – 10,000| 13,000 – 15,000| Spacious for families
Tempo Traveller| 12,000 – 15,000| 20,000 – 22,000| Best for groups

Delhi to Kainchi Dham by Bus
Overview
A cost-effective and scenic option, perfect for solo travelers or backpackers. Buses don’t go directly to Kainchi Dham, but you can travel up to Bhowali or Nainital, then take a local taxi.
Route 1: Delhi → Nainital → Kainchi Dham
1. Board Bus: From Delhi’s Anand Vihar ISBT to Nainital.
2. Travel Duration: ~8–9 hours.
3. From Nainital: Hire a local taxi (₹500–₹800) or shared jeep to Kainchi Dham (17 km).
Delhi → Haldwani → Kainchi Dham
1. Take an overnight Volvo or government bus to Haldwani.
2. From Haldwani, hire a private taxi or shared cab (approx. ₹1,000–₹1,500) to reach the temple (45 km).
Bus Types and Fares (2025)
Type| Operator| Fare (₹)| Duration
Ordinary| UTC Govt.| 500 – 700| 9–10 hr
AC Seater| Uttarakhand Roadways| 800 – 1,000| 8–9 hr
Volvo (Deluxe)| Private| 1,000 – 1,400| 7–8 hr
Sleeper AC| Private| 1,200 – 1,600| Overnight 8 hr

Delhi to Kainchi Dham by Train
Overview
Train travel offers comfort and scenic beauty at an affordable price. The nearest railway station to Kainchi Dham is Kathgodam, about 38 km away.
Major Trains from Delhi to Kathgodam
Train Name| Train No.| Departure (Delhi)| Arrival (Kathgodam)| Duration
Ranikhet Express| 15013| 10:05 PM (Old Delhi Jn)| 5:05 AM| 7 hr
Uttar Sampark Kranti Express| 15035| 4:00 PM (Delhi)| 10:45 PM| 6 hr 45 min
Shatabdi Express| 12040| 6:20 AM (New Delhi)| 11:40 AM| 5 hr 20 min
Kathgodam Express| 16015| 11:15 PM (Delhi Junction)| 7:10 AM| 8 hr
From Kathgodam to Kainchi Dham
- Distance: ~38 km
- Taxi Fare: ₹900 – ₹1,200
- Duration: 1.5 hours via Bhimtal – Bhowali route

Delhi to Kainchi Dham by Flight
Overview
Though there is no airport directly at Kainchi Dham, you can fly from Delhi to Pantnagar Airport, which is the nearest airstrip (about 75 km away). From there, hire a taxi to reach the temple.
Flight Route
Delhi (DEL) ✈️ Pantnagar (PGH) → Taxi to Kainchi Dham
Airlines Operating
- IndiGo, Alliance Air, SpiceJet (seasonal)
Flight Time and Cost
- Duration: ~1 hour flight + 2 hours by road
- Fare: ₹2,500 – ₹4,500 (one-way)
Pantnagar to Kainchi Dham Taxi
- Distance: ~75 km
- Time: 2–2.5 hr
- Fare: ₹1,800 – ₹2,500

Nearby Attractions to Kainchi Dham
Make the most of your trip by exploring these stunning destinations within 20–30 km:
1. Nainital (17 km)
The famous hill station offers boating on Naini Lake, cable car rides, and the Naina Devi Temple. Ideal for a day trip after darshan.
2. Bhimtal (22 km)
Quieter than Nainital, known for its large lake and scenic island café.
3. Bhowali (9 km)
A charming hill market, known as the fruit bowl of Kumaon.
4. Ghorakhal Temple (11 km)
Dedicated to Lord Golu Devta, believed to grant wishes written on paper.
5. Naukuchiatal (27 km)
The lake with nine corners—great for paragliding, kayaking, and nature walks.

Things to Know Before Visiting Kainchi Dham
Temple Etiquette
- Dress modestly; avoid loud conversations or photography inside the temple.
- Remove footwear before entering the main shrine.
- Offer prasad or fruits as per tradition.
- Maintain silence during aartis and bhajans.
Local Food to Try
- Aloo ke gutke, bhatt ki churkani, gahat ki dal, and bal mithai are regional delicacies found in nearby towns.
- Visit local dhabas in Bhowali or Haldwani for authentic taste.
Festivals
- Kainchi Dham Mela (June 15): Celebrates the ashram’s foundation day. Thousands gather for bhandara (feast) and kirtan.
- Hanuman Jayanti: Special pooja and bhajans at the ashram.
